Fuse has released the opening track from “The Man with the Iron Fists,” a ninja flick directed and co-written by Wu-Tang Clan’s RZA. Fuse describes “The Baddest Man Alive,” as “a swampy, creeping track that re-imagines the desolation and eeriness of an Ennio Morricone track as produced by B.B. King.” Brought to you by RZA and blues rock band The Black Keys.

Give it a listen, via Fuse:

The movie, starring Russell Crowe and Lucy Liu, features new music from Kanye West, Wiz Khalifa and the Wu-Tang Clan as well and will be released Nov. 2.
